Job Responsibilities

The Staff/Senior Project Controls Specialist leads project controls processes and consults with the project management team to ensure client satisfaction. This specialist will present schedule and budget status reports to the project management team and client.

Other responsibilities include but are not limited to:

- Validate proper set-up and management of the Enterprise Planning & Controls software.

- Analyze data, logs, and reports in the Enterprise Planning & Controls software or other tools.

- Validate proper Work Breakdown Structure (WBS) is utilized.

- Develop effective scheduling reports, cost reports, cash flow reports and forecasts for multiple projects.

- Develop, implement, and manage the reporting data warehouse to produce valuable program controls reports and

data for multiple large projects.

- Provide leadership and training to team members ensuring the resolution of difficult project control issues.

- Develop and implement project execution plans.

- Develop and maintain effective relationships with existing and potential clients, customers, and contractors.

- Responsible for engineering, procurement, and construction planning, scheduling, logistics and cost control.

- Serve as a point of contact for technical questions from the project team.

- Validate the accuracy of cost management and forecast reporting.

- Interface with the Project Management Team and Accounting Department to review project costs and contingency

costs and support external audits.

- Experience in negotiation of prime agreements, construction contracts/subcontracts agreements.

- Review upstream (prime contract) / downstream (purchase orders & subcontract) change orders.

- Analyze cash flow reports.

- Lead the Interactive Project Planning Meetings (IPPM).

- Lead the presentation of Project Controls reporting.

- Validate schedule progress.

- Analyze and evaluate schedule management involving the critical path method of scheduling techniques,

estimating, project cost management, forecasting and document control.

- Perform schedule what-if scenarios.

- Validate the accuracy of earned value management system reporting.

- Analyze progress measurement.

- Analyze progress curves.

- Perform and review material takeoffs.

- Identify and oversee the Risk Management process.

- Perform quality checks and inspections on project controls deliverables.

- Perform field audits to validate accuracy of reporting and processes.

- Perform Project Forensic Analysis.

- Performs other duties as assigned

- Complies with all policies and standards
